Hello, I've recently swapped a screen in hp pavilion 

 

 

 

15-CW1598SA. It worked fine for a couple weeks then I ran the antivirus it blue screened.

 

Then it wouldn't load into window's , displayed no hardrive,

 

 

 

So I tryed the ssd in reader nothing dead.

 

 

 

 I brought a new ssd, downloaded the hp recovery tool then attempted to reload the image . It displays administrator as if going to load on the desktop then changes to restarting, then restarts then blue screens. The Recovery fails just gets stuck and displays driver power state failure.

 

 

 

All the advice ,explains its power, its drivers ,settings etc but I cant get on the laptop to change anthing.

 

 

 

Please help im struggling ‌‌‌‌‌😪‌‌‌‌‌ .....

 

 

 

 

 

Also removed battery nothing, reseated ram in either slots nothing, its not getting hot or overloading.

 

 

 

So I'm Lost.... been on 2 weeks solid nothing.

Let's perform a hard reset:

 

  • Power off the laptop.
  • Disconnected AC adapter from the laptop.
  • Press and hold the power button for 15 seconds.
  • Reconnect the battery and plug the AC adapter.
  • Power ON the laptop and check.
